organic bean to cup coffee machine to cup machines don't use pre-ground coffee beans, which lose their flavor. Instead they grind the beans in a matter of seconds before making the coffee. They can also heat and texturize the milk to make barista-style coffee at the touch of an button.

The machines also reduce the amount of waste and training costs since they perform all the work.

They brew one cup of coffee at a single time

Bean to cup machines grind and brew coffee beans right in the front of you. They also let you make a wide variety of drinks, including cappuccinos, lattes, espresso and many more. They are popular in commercial settings due to the fact that they can make high-quality coffee without the need for a professional barista. This makes them ideal for offices, cafes, and restaurants.

They use a whole bean that is ground right before the brewing. This keeps the aroma and richness of the coffee. This gives them an exceptional taste compared to other coffee machines that make use of pre-ground coffee that goes stale quickly. bean to cup coffee maker-to-cup machines are easy to use and come with a range of features that can be adapted to suit your preferences.

The quality of your water can affect the flavor of your coffee, and a coffee-to-cup machine will help ensure that your water is safe and filtered for optimal flavour. Numerous models can analyze your water and recommend the best filter for your needs. This can also reduce the mineral content in your coffee, which could give it a metallic taste or other unpleasant aspects.

Certain models allow you to adjust your grinding size to match your preferences. Certain models, like the Faema X30 will automatically adjust the settings to ensure a perfect brew every time. This feature is particularly beneficial when you're a home-based user, as it will save you the burden of grinding and measuring your own beans every day.

They are also simple to maintain, with a rinse cycle before turning off, and a container for the grounds that have been used up at the end of the making process. The majority of machines have a visual indicator that will let you know when the bin is full.

Many bean-to-cup machines also make a variety of hot drinks, including warm chocolate and herbal teas. They also can be used to make cold drinks, like iced coffee and iced tea. They are perfect for workplaces since they can improve employee productivity and well-being.
